Next off, we will certainly explore the attributes, makes use of, and Pros and Cons of each type of healthcare facility bed in depth. A manual healthcare facility bed is the many basic type of medical facility bed, and all modification features are attained through a hand-cranked tool.


These hand-cranked devices are generally mounted at the foot or side of the bed, and the caretaker or client can readjust the height or tilt angle of the bed by drinking the manage. Given that no electrical parts are required, are usually more affordable than electrical hospital beds, suitable for clinical establishments or family members with restricted budget plans.

For people who need to adjust their posture or elevation frequently, manual beds may not be practical sufficient because each adjustment requires hands-on procedure. If the bed needs to be readjusted regularly, nursing personnel might require to invest more physical toughness to operate the hand-cranked gadget - hospital beds for home use. Handbook beds are typically appropriate for people in the healing duration or occasions with reduced nursing needs

Contrasted with hand-operated medical facility beds, semi-electric medical facility beds are more practical in changing the back and legs, specifically for individuals that need to change their posture frequently.


Because only some features depend on electricity, semi-electric healthcare facility beds consume less power during usage. Since the total elevation still requires to be adjusted by hand, it may not be as practical as totally electric medical facility beds for individuals who require to adjust the bed height frequently. Compared to hands-on healthcare facility beds, semi-electric healthcare facility beds are a little extra intricate to operate, requiring users to understand the mix of electrical and manual procedures.


Electric healthcare facility beds have high adjustment precision and can be specifically gotten used to a particular angle and elevation according to the needs of people to offer the most comfy assistance. All-electric healthcare facility beds are normally outfitted with a range of additional features, such as integrated ranges, cushion stress change, etc, to satisfy the unique needs of various patients.

A low bed is a specifically created health center bed that can be adapted to an extremely reduced degree, generally just a few inches from the ground. The objective of this style is to decrease the threat of clients falling from the bed, specifically for people that are at risk of dropping, such as the senior or clients with limited mobility.

The extensive care bed (ICU Bed) is made for the intensive care system (ICU) and has extensive tracking and nursing functions. This type of bed is typically furnished with interfaces for a variety of monitoring equipment, which can keep an eye on the person's essential indicators in actual time, such as he said heart price, blood stress, respiration, etc.

You might require to buy the tools. You may be able to select whether to rent or acquire the devices. Make sure your medical professionals and DME providers are enrolled in Medicare. It's likewise important to ask a distributor if they take part in Medicare before you get DME. If suppliers are joining Medicare, they must approve task (which implies, they can bill you only the coinsurance and Component B deductible for the Medicareapproved amount).
